Summary: A Junior Corporate Accountant is tasked with supporting financial accounting and reporting within a company. This role involves preparing financial statements, assisting with audits, and ensuring compliance with accounting principles. The position requires collaboration with various departments to enhance financial planning and analysis. The ideal candidate will have a background in accounting and relevant experience in a public company setting.
Key Responsibilities:
- Assisting with the preparation of financial statements, including balance sheets, income statements, and cash flow statements.
- Assisting with the preparation of monthly, quarterly, and annual financial reports.
- Performing account reconciliations and ensuring accuracy of financial data.
- Assisting with budgeting and forecasting processes.
- Supporting the annual audit process by providing documentation and explanations for financial transactions.
- Assisting with accounts payable and accounts receivable processes.
- Preparing journal entries and maintaining general ledger accounts.
- Analyzing financial data and preparing ad-hoc reports as needed.
- Ensuring compliance with accounting principles and company policies.
- Collaborating with other departments to support financial planning and analysis efforts.
Key Skills:
- Bachelor's degree in Accounting or equivalent (CPA preferred).
- 2-4 years of related experience at large public company or auditing large public companies.
- Demonstrated knowledge and understanding of Accounting theory, principles, practices and regulations including FASB/GAAP and SOX compliance.
- Demonstrated ability to document a broad range of issues in work papers, disclosures and memos.
- Strong analytical skills in evaluating data and the ability to exercise judgment in a variety of areas.
- Demonstrated successful use of technology to improve process efficiency.
- Effective teambuilding and leadership skills.
- Demonstrated project management skills.
- Commitment to highest standards of quality and integrity.
- Exude a high degree of professionalism and treats others with respect.
